Chris, I have the Pro Diamond and the 3D thumb pull, which is just like the Pro Diamond except the thumb trigger is different. I really like these releases, and to be honest, I think I like the 3D thumb pull model a little better. Go to a shop and compare them, if possible. While the head does swivel 360 deg., you must lock it into the position you want. That's not real obvious from the advertising. If you are shooting with a loop, I highly recommend getting one with the Talon head, which is designed for a loop. Personally, I think this release is one of the best thumb triggered releases for hunting, as it is very quite. Other releases, like the Carters or the Chappy Boss, are double sear releases and have an audible click when cocked or triggered. These are better suited for 3D or target.

i purchased the 3-d thumb pull last year and have no complaints.mine is just the standard caliper model and swivels 360 degrees. the trigger sensitivity is very adjustable. i used it for hunting and it worked great. it did take some getting used to since i was always using index finger trigger releases.
